Recognizing the Art Behind Metal Stamping


At its core, metal stamping is the procedure of transforming flat steel sheets right into particular shapes via pressure and precision. This isn't a one-size-fits-all procedure; it entails a number of techniques like flexing, punching, coining, and embossing-- each picked for the job available. Every bend and cut is performed with amazing precision, assisted by the tools and passes away crafted for the task.


This process requires greater than just machines-- it calls for a skilled group and advanced modern technology. The creativity of tool and die shops lies in developing custom-made dies that permit the precise recreation of parts, to the smallest information. Whether creating simple braces or complex vehicle components, accuracy is non-negotiable.


How Metal Stamping Powers Modern Living


Check out your home or office and you'll locate countless products gave birth to by metal stamping. The structural framework of your dish washer, the connectors in your smart device, the bracket holding your vehicle's dashboard-- all these components owe their presence to stamped metal.


In the vehicle globe, the need for toughness and uniformity makes progressive die stamping a preferred. This method entails a series of stations, each doing an one-of-a-kind function as the metal advancements with journalism. It's ideal for high-volume runs and guarantees each piece satisfies exacting criteria.


But it doesn't stop with automobiles. In the clinical area, where integrity can be a matter of necessity, metal stamping is used to craft medical devices and tool parts. In the aerospace sector, marked components have to take on severe problems while satisfying tight tolerances. The same is true in customer electronic devices, where space-saving, high-functionality layouts require stamped metal aspects that are both lightweight and solid.


Accuracy, Speed, and Reliability: Why Metal Stamping Matters


So why has metal stamping come to be such a best method throughout many markets? First and foremost: rate. Once the passes away are established, thousands of identical components can be generated with little variant. This degree of repeatability is vital when uniformity matters.


Then there's the question of cost-effectiveness. Typical machining might take longer and involve even more material waste. But marking, particularly when finished with progressive die innovation, keeps manufacturing scooting and efficiently. It's one of the most intelligent ways to meet high-volume production goals without giving up high quality.
